Summary
- Dr. Nathan Escorial is based in Loma Linda, CA, and specializes in Emergency Medicine with a subspecialty in Critical Care Medicine. He earned his medical degree in 2021 from the University of Nevada, Reno School of Medicine. He completed his residency in Emergency Medicine at Desert Regional Medical Center from 2021 to 2024, and is currently in a Critical Care Fellowship at Loma Linda University Medical Center. Dr. Escorial holds a BS in Biochemistry also from the University of Nevada, Reno. He has published a case report titled "Spontaneous Coronary Artery Dissection Presenting as Electrical Storm" in Clinical Practice and Cases in Emergency Medicine.
